MenuItemCollection Constructor (MenuItem)

Initializes a new instance of the MenuItemCollection class using the specified parent menu item (or owner).

Namespace:  System.Web.UI.WebControls
Assembly:  System.Web (in System.Web.dll)

public:
MenuItemCollection(
	MenuItem^ owner
)

Parameters

owner
Type: System.Web.UI.WebControls::MenuItem
A MenuItem that represents the parent menu item of the current MenuItemCollection.

Use this constructor to initialize a new instance of the MenuItemCollection class using the specified parent menu item (or owner). This constructor is commonly used when creating a collection of child menu items where you need to specify the parent menu item.

NoteNote

When creating a collection of root menu items, consider using the default constructor because root menu items do not have a parent menu item.

This constructor is used primarily by control developers when extending the MenuItem class to initialize the ChildItems property.
